News Release: Chamber President Announces Resignation
October 23, 2023Dear Chamber Members and Friends,
With mixed emotions, I am writing to let you know I have submitted my letter of resignation as President of the Beaver County Chamber of Commerce. This decision is prompted by my husband's acceptance of a position at the Nashville Rescue Mission, necessitating our relocation. It has been a distinct privilege and honor to serve the Chamber, and I extend my heartfelt gratitude for this opportunity. I am committed to assisting with a smooth transition and will continue to work full-time until November 10, 2023. My resignation comes with both sorrow and affection. It is because of the staff of the Chamber and the leadership of our Board of Directors that I can assure you there will be a smooth transition in my departure.
Our Board of Directors has formed a search committee, made up of members of our Executive Committee and Personnel Committee, to begin the search for a new President of the Chamber. Information on the job will be posted soon. In the interim, if you have questions on one of our upcoming events, please reach out to Molly or Peggy on our Chamber staff. If you have any questions regarding the transition, ideas for the future structure of the Chamber, or leads on someone you might think would be interested in the position – I kindly ask that you email Lindsay Courteau, Chair of our Board of Directors at lcourteau@bcchamber.com.
